The Problem

AI coding agents can't see your screen. When you find a bug, you context-switch into writing mode -- describing the layout issue in text, manually screenshotting, cropping, and dragging images into the right spot. You speak at 150 words per minute but type at 60. The context is lost in translation.

The Solution

markupR is a desktop capture app first. You hit a hotkey, narrate what you see, and stop. Then it runs a post-session pipeline that aligns transcript timestamps with the recording, extracts the right frames, and outputs structured Markdown your agent can execute against immediately.

  • Record -- press a hotkey, talk through what you see
  • Process -- Whisper transcribes, ffmpeg extracts frames at the exact moments you described
  • Enrich -- capture context is attached to shot markers (cursor position, active window/app, focused element hints when available)
  • Output -- structured Markdown with screenshots and context your agent can trust
Cmd+Shift+F  -->  talk  -->  Cmd+Shift+F  -->  Cmd+V into your agent

Context-Aware Capture: What Your Agent Actually Gets

Every important frame can carry extra machine-usable context, not just pixels.

  • Cursor coordinates at capture time
  • Active app + window title (best-effort from OS context)
  • Focused element hints (role/text/title hints when available)
  • Trigger metadata (manual, pause, or voice-command)

This makes the report a high-signal liaison between you and your agent: what you said, what you saw, and where your attention was.

MCP Server

Give your AI coding agent eyes and ears. Add markupR as an MCP server and it can capture screenshots, record your screen with voice, and receive structured reports -- all mid-conversation.

Setup

Claude Code (~/.claude/settings.json):

{
  "mcpServers": {
    "markupR": {
      "command": "npx",
      "args": ["--yes", "--package", "markupr", "markupr-mcp"]
    }
  }
}

Cursor / Windsurf -- same config in your MCP settings.

Tools

Tool Description
capture_screenshot Grab the current screen and attach context metadata (cursor + active app/window + focus hints when available).
capture_with_voice Record screen + mic for a set duration. Returns a structured report.
analyze_video Process any existing .mov or .mp4 into Markdown with extracted frames (fallback path for externally captured recordings).
analyze_screenshot Run a screenshot through the AI analysis pipeline.
start_recording Begin an interactive recording session.
stop_recording End the session and run the full pipeline.

CLI

Installation

# Run without installing
npx markupr analyze ./recording.mov

# Or install globally
npm install -g markupr

Commands

markupr analyze <video> -- Process an existing screen recording into structured Markdown.

markupr analyze ./bug-demo.mov
markupr analyze ./recording.mov --output ./reports
markupr analyze ./recording.mov --template github-issue
markupr analyze ./recording.mov --no-frames  # transcript only

markupr watch [directory] -- Watch for new recordings and auto-process them.

markupr watch ~/Desktop --output ./reports

markupr push github <report> -- Create GitHub issues from a feedback report.

markupr push github ./report.md --repo myorg/myapp
markupr push github ./report.md --repo myorg/myapp --dry-run

markupr push linear <report> -- Create Linear issues from a feedback report.

markupr push linear ./report.md --team ENG

Output Templates

markdown (default) | json | github-issue | linear | jira | html

Requirements

  • Node.js 18+
  • ffmpeg on your PATH (brew install ffmpeg / apt install ffmpeg / choco install ffmpeg)

How It Works

                    +-----------+
  Screen + Voice -> | Whisper   | -> Timestamped transcript
                    +-----------+
                         |
                    +-----------+
                    | Analyzer  | -> Key moments identified
                    +-----------+
                         |
                    +-----------+
                    | ffmpeg    | -> Frames extracted at exact timestamps
                    +-----------+
                         |
                    +-----------+
                    | Generator | -> Structured Markdown with inline screenshots
                    +-----------+

The pipeline degrades gracefully. No ffmpeg? Transcript-only output. No Whisper model? Timer-based screenshots. No API keys? Everything runs locally.
